Prevent 'click anywhere in slide'
Hi all, I'm using PP2016 and would like to know if it is possible to disable advancing slides by clicking anywhere in the slide. I want users to click only on the various buttons to advance to different slides in my presentation.

You can use Kiosk mode (Slide Show > set up show) BUT this will also disable on click animations.
